What to expect

The Postmaster Remuneration Advisor is a key member of the Central Finance team, responsible for supporting the delivery of functional strategies, always modelling the Post Office behaviours and demonstrating a Postmaster first mindset.

The Postmaster Remuneration Advisor will work as part of the team responsible for ensuring monthly remuneration and any other Expense payments are paid accurately and on time. The role involves maintaining Success Factors with all Postmaster joiner, leaver and changes information.They will act as a main point of contact for all questions relating to Postmaster remuneration whilst displaying a culture of inclusion, continuous improvement, and high performance.

Job Specific Accountabilities include:

  • Accurately process Postmaster remuneration in line with agreed timelines.
  • Accurately process Postmaster remuneration expense payments in line with agreed timelines.
  • Maintain and update Postmaster details in internal systems (joiners, leavers, changes).
  • Act as the first point of contact for routine Postmaster remuneration queries, providing clear and helpful responses.
  • Carry out data entry and basic financial checks to ensure accuracy and compliance.
  • Completion of account balance reconciliations on a daily and monthly basis
  • Determining the necessary accounting entries to correct accounting errors
  • Support the monthly payroll and expense cycle by resolving simple issues promptly.
